2. The Hidden Cost of Substandard Components
Many organizations are tempted to cut costs by sourcing cheaper, non-genuine parts. However, this short-term saving often results in long-term expenses due to:
- Frequent replacements
- Equipment wear and tear
- Safety risks
- Increased energy consumption
- Downtime due to unexpected failures

3. Preventive and Predictive Maintenance
Preventive and predictive maintenance are powerful strategies in maximizing equipment lifespan. With the right spare parts and condition-monitoring tools, issues can be detected and resolved before they cause system failure.
